I'm using the docker container on Ubuntu server OS installed on an Intel i5-7500T machine. I am trying to automate the conversion via the /watch directory.
I was able to create a preset from the webgui to select H265 encode.
I would also like to ensure audio passthrough and (if possible) subtitle passthrough.
Manually I can set it the passthrough for a file/ conversion job, but when I try to save it as a preset I see that it has no effect.
So my Question is whether it is actually possible to set audio and subtitle passthrough as a preset?
My intention is to convert to H265 to reduce file size and keep CPU utilization low (QSV for the video encoding) by not doing audio decode-encode.
